Options to control overclocking and overvoltage in PM is the same as in CM. F.e. -cclock -1200 -mclock 2000.
Just read the readme file on the PM miner folder.
Don't be lazy, read it. Mining does not tolerate laziness.
If you didn't place any options to control clocks and voltages, PM wouldn't touch these parameters at all.

Short story answer is use Claymore  Cool

I was using it for 3+ years, but 2days ago 4gb 580 and 570 sapphire stop working, not enough memory to create dag.
I still have working 4gb rigs on Claymore, but if i stop them, and restart only miner, it will not create DAG again,

Do u have solutin for working 4gb rigs with Claymore? I have enabled IGPU, -eres 0 or 1 dont work anymore...

so...

so i tryed Phoenix, and it works...for 4GB - but even when i dont put any command line in miner_start (not even -tt), the new drivers are in control of my fan speed (but it doesnt works fine, 'cos all GPU temp's are 75c°)
Ill try to put fixed min and maxed speed lines for fan speed, maybe that will work...
